John Marzano #757


This week, Johnny Marz! Born and raised in South Philadelphia, John Marzano and his dad spent hundreds of hours working on his swing. That work made him a star for the Temple Owls and Team USA! He was a first round pick for the Boston Red Sox but never established himself as a starter. But through hard work and a great attitude, Marzano played 10 seasons in MLB! After his playing days, Marzano went into broadcasting with the Philadelphia Phillies. He did the postgame show and was a funny and engaging personality, but sadly his life was cut short by an accident. He passed away in 2008 at just 45 years old. 
RIP John Marzano.

Herm Winningham #614


This week, it's Reds Hot Rapper Herm Winningham! Herm Winningham was drafted in the 1st Round of 3 different MLB drafts, finally signing with the Mets. He had played only 14 MLB games when he was part of the trade that brought Gary Carter to NY. Herm would play 4 seasons with the Expos, 4 with the Reds, and end his career in Boston. While with the Reds he scored the winning run in 1990 World Series Game 4 after bunting for a hit on an 0-2 count!

Bob Horner #50T

 


This week, a Golden Spikes winner, #1 pick, all star, NPB slugger Bob Horner! Bob had an amazing home run rate with Atlanta and could have been a 500 Home Run hitter if not for injuries. His first 3 seasons he averaged 44 homers per 162 games, unfortunately he never came close to playing 162 games. He had the potential to be an all time great...but injuries and collusion forced him to NPB at 28. He was a star in one season for the Yakult Swallows hitting .327 with 31 homers. He returned briefly to MLB for this card!
